AO05 JTU is a 2005 Chevrolet Lacetti in Blue with a 1,399c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 2005 Chevrolet Lacetti models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.6% with a typical mileage of 52,333 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Chevrolet Lacetti f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 8,485 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AO05 JTU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Chevrolet Lacetti typ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 21 years old, this Chevrolet Lacetti is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
